Problem
Existing M2M systems face challenges in protecting data from misuse, preventing personal information exposure, and concealing user behaviors from hackers.
Innovation Solution
A method and apparatus that involves generating and storing fake data of the same type as real data within a resource, allowing access-controlled users to see only the real data while others are presented with fake data, thereby masking data trends.

The present disclosure relates to hiding data trends in a machine-to-machine (M2M) system. A method for operating a first device in a machine-to-machine (M2M) system may include: performing a registration procedure for a second device; receiving real data generated by the second device; obtaining fake data of an identical type as the real data; and storing the real data and the fake data in a same resource.
